DLSA Gbl observes “World Environment Day”

Ganderbal, June 4: The District Legal Services Authority (DLSA) Ganderbal in collaboration with Government Boys Higher Secondary School Ganderbal today observed “World Environment Day” at Government Boys Higher Secondary School Ganderbal.

The programme was held under the guidance and directions of Tabasum, Secretary DLSA Ganderbal.

The Programme was attended by Principal Government Boys Higher Secondary School Ganderbal, Staff members of Chief Education office among others.

The Programme was spearheaded by Advocate Abid Jeelani who deliberated on the importance of observing World Environment Day. The theme of World Environment Day 2022 is Only One Earth, focusing on “Living Sustainably in Harmony with Nature”.

Ghulam Hassan Bhat Principal of Government Boys Higher Secondary School Ganderbal stated that our environment is one of the most important aspects to survive on this planet. He encouraged the participants that it is the duty of every citizen to make our surrounding clean and pollution free and appealed to everyone to take care of the environment.

Ghulam Hassan Sheikh, Muzaffar Ahmad Shah, Lecturers deliberated on the importance of observing World Environment Day. They said that rivers and lakes play an important role in maintaining and restoring the ecological balance and act as sources of drinking water, recharge groundwater, control floods, support biodiversity, and provide livelihood opportunities to a large number of people.
